2.1 Classic Pizza Toppings
Classic pizza toppings are Timeless favorites that have stood the test of time. These toppings are beloved by pizza enthusiasts all over the world for their delicious simplicity and ability to satisfy cravings. Some classic pizza toppings include:
- Pepperoni: The king of pizza toppings, pepperoni is a cured and spiced Italian-American salami. Its savory and slightly spicy flavor pairs perfectly with gooey melted cheese.
- Mushrooms: The earthy and meaty flavor of mushrooms make them a popular topping choice. Whether you prefer button, cremini, or shiitake mushrooms, their unique taste and texture add depth to any pizza.
- Green peppers: Crisp and slightly bitter, green peppers provide a refreshing contrast to richer toppings. Their vibrant color also adds visual appeal to your pizza.
- Onions: Whether caramelized or raw, onions add a sweet and slightly tangy flavor to pizzas. They can be used as a primary topping or as a flavor enhancer in combination with other ingredients.
- Black olives: Briny and salty, black olives provide a burst of Mediterranean flavor to pizzas. They pair well with most other toppings and add a unique touch to any slice.
2.2 Unique Pizza Toppings
For those seeking a culinary adventure, unique pizza toppings offer unexpected combinations and flavors that push the boundaries of traditional pizza. These toppings are perfect for those seeking to try something new and exciting. Some unique pizza toppings include:
- Artichoke hearts: With their mild and slightly tangy flavor, artichoke hearts add a gourmet twist to pizzas. Their tender texture pairs well with creamy cheeses and rich sauces.
- Prosciutto: This thinly sliced Italian cured ham adds a delicate and savory flavor to pizzas. Its slightly salty taste pairs wonderfully with sweet or tangy toppings.
- Fig Jam: For a touch of sweetness, fig jam provides a unique flavor profile to pizzas. The combination of its natural sweetness and subtle tartness creates a harmonious balance of flavors.
- Arugula: With its peppery and slightly bitter taste, arugula adds a fresh and vibrant element to pizzas. It is best added as a topping after the pizza is baked to maintain its crispness.
- Truffle oil: The rich and earthy flavor of truffle oil elevates any pizza. Its unique aroma and flavor make it a luxurious topping choice for those looking for a gourmet experience.
2.3 Vegetarian Pizza Toppings
Vegetarian pizza toppings offer a variety of delicious options for those who prefer a plant-Based diet. These toppings provide ample flavor and texture, ensuring that vegetarian pizzas are just as satisfying as their meaty counterparts. Some vegetarian pizza toppings include:
- Bell peppers: In addition to their vibrant colors, bell peppers provide a sweet and crunchy texture to vegetarian pizzas. They can be used in combination with other vegetables for a flavor-packed slice.
- Fresh tomatoes: Juicy and bursting with flavor, fresh tomatoes add a refreshing element to vegetarian pizzas. They can be used either sliced or diced, depending on the desired texture.
- Spinach: Whether used as a topping or as a base layer, spinach adds a nutritious and vibrant element to vegetarian pizzas. Its mild flavor pairs well with a variety of cheeses and other vegetables.
- Sun-dried tomatoes: With their intense and concentrated flavor, sun-dried tomatoes provide a burst of umami to vegetarian pizzas. Their chewy texture adds a unique element to each bite.
- Feta cheese: Creamy and tangy, feta cheese adds a rich and savory flavor to vegetarian pizzas. Its crumbly texture pairs well with other vegetables and Mediterranean-inspired toppings.
2.4 Meat Lover's Pizza Toppings
For those who enjoy the indulgence of meat on their pizzas, meat lover's toppings offer a variety of options to satisfy even the heartiest appetites. These toppings provide a hearty and savory flavor profile that complements the other ingredients. Some meat lover's pizza toppings include:
- Italian sausage: Flavorful and slightly spicy, Italian sausage adds depth and richness to pizzas. Its crumbly texture and robust taste make it a popular pizza topping choice.
- Bacon: Crispy and smoky, bacon adds a burst of savory flavor to pizzas. Its combination of fat, salt, and meatiness creates a delicious and satisfying taste.
- Grilled chicken: Tender and flavorful, grilled chicken adds a lean protein option to pizzas. Its versatility allows it to pair well with a variety of other toppings and sauces.
- Ground beef: Seasoned and cooked ground beef adds a classic meaty flavor to pizzas. Its versatility makes it a popular choice for various pizza styles and combinations.
- Pepperoni: As a timeless favorite, pepperoni is a must-have for meat lovers. Its bold and slightly spicy flavor makes it a staple topping for pizza enthusiasts.
2.5 Gourmet Pizza Toppings
For those looking to elevate their pizza experience, gourmet toppings offer a range of high-quality ingredients and unique flavor combinations. These toppings often incorporate specialty products and ingredients that Create a sophisticated and indulgent pizza experience. Some gourmet pizza toppings include:
- Fresh mozzarella: Creamy and subtly tangy, fresh mozzarella adds a touch of indulgence to pizzas. Its mild flavor and soft texture make it a versatile gourmet topping choice.
- Provolone cheese: With its sharp and nutty flavor, provolone cheese adds richness and depth to gourmet pizzas. Its melting capabilities create a gooey and satisfying layer on top.
- Gorgonzola cheese: This Blue cheese provides a pungent and creamy flavor to gourmet pizzas. Its distinctive taste pairs well with rich and bold toppings such as caramelized onions or figs.
- Pancetta: Similar to bacon, pancetta is an Italian cured pork belly that adds a rich and savory flavor to pizzas. Its texture is slightly softer and less smoky than bacon.
- Fresh basil: Fragrant and herbaceous, fresh basil adds a burst of freshness to gourmet pizzas. Its bright green color and delicate flavor elevate the overall taste and presentation.
